- Wire of top electronic module (marked "A") for ignition circuit A.
- Wire of bottom electronic module (marked "B") for ignition circuit B.
NOTE: Ignition circuit A controls: top spark plugs of cylinder
1 and 2; lower spark plugs of cylinder 3 and 4.
Ignition circuit B controls: top spark plugs of cylinder
3 and 4; lower spark plugs of cylinder 1 and 2.
CAUTION: The electromagnetic compatibility (EMC) and electro-
magnetic interference (EMI) depends essentially on
the wire used. See Fig. 73.
Min. section area: 2x 0,75 mm
2
(18 AMG) (shielded
flexible cable, shielding braid on both ends grounded
to prevent EMI (e.g specification MIL-27500/18).
No or insufficient shielded cables can cause engine
shut-off due to electromagnetic and radio interfer-
ence.
The metal base of each ignition switch must be
grounded to aircraft frame to prevent EMI.

17.3.5) Electric starter
See Fig. 74.
Wire from starter relay to the electric starter
- cross section of at least 16 mm
2
(6 AWG)
- output: 0,7 kW / 0,9 kW optional
- positive terminal (1): M6 screw (tightening torque 4 Nm (35 in.lb))
suitable for ring terminal to DIN 46225 ((MIL-T-7928) (PIDG) or
equivalent)
- grounding: via engine block
CAUTION: Suitable for short starting periods only.
CAUTION: Max. 80 °C (176 °F) temperature range by the electric
starter housing. Activate starter for max. 10 sec.
(without interruption), followed by a cooling period of 2
min!
